What is RAID-10 SSD Storage?

RAID-10, which is also known as RAID 1+0, is actually a combination of RAID-0 and RAID-1 and offers high performance and good fault resistance. Featuring SSD (Solid State Drive) caching for faster read/write speeds, and data redundancy.

For the setup, you will need a minimum of four SSDs. Half of them are used for mirroring and the other half are used for striping.

RAID-10 vs Other RAID Configurations

Feature RAID-0 RAID-1 RAID-5 RAID-10
Data Redundancy
Performance ⚠️ Moderate ⚠️ Moderate
Minimum Disks Needed 2 2 3 4
Fault Tolerance ✅ (1 disk) ✅ (multiple)
Storage Efficiency 100% 50% ~67% 50%

RAID-10 gives a little of both worlds: it's fast and it's redundant. The same can't be said for RAID-0 (for lack of safety) or RAID-5 (for slower write times).

MYTH: SSDs don’t fail, so RAID isn’t necessary.

Fact: SSDs can die with no warning whatsoever. RAID-10 adds a safety net.

Do I still need backups with RAID 10?

Yes. RAID-10 does not protect against losing data due to accidental deletion, cyber attacks or data corruption. Keep independent backups at all times.

How many SSDs do I need for RAID-10?

You need at least four SSDs: two to be striped and two to be mirrored.
